Don't call BuildInitialTrace() for entry gateways.
We're going to call it to connect the entry and target gateways anyway, so all we need are gateways at 22.5 degrees to setup entry at +/- 45 degrees from the current direction. Fixes https://gitlab.com/kicad/code/kicad/issues/14324 Fixes https://gitlab.com/kicad/code/kicad/issues/12459
